Nebraska court strips medical marijuana measure from ballot

by Associated Press
| September 11, 2020 12:03 AM

LINCOLN, Neb. (AP) — Nebraska voters won't get the chance to legalize medical marijuana this year after the state Supreme Court ruled Thursday that the measure set to appear on the November ballot is unconstitutional.
